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Montegut, LA

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Montegut, LA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ect your actual costs. Our team will provide a personalized est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Extraction $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ment costs
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Equipment costs, labor costs, drying time
Flooring Repl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Type of flooring, size of affected area, material costs
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Scope of work, equipment costs, labor costs
More Services (mold remediation, structural repair) $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repairs, equipment costs

Q: How do I prevent water damage in the future?

A: To prevent water damage, ensure that your home’s gutters and downspouts are clear, inspect your roof regularly for damage, and consider installing a sump pump or French drain in areas prone to water accumulation.
